The scribes and Pharisees contend against Jesus—He heals the daughter of a gentile woman—He feeds the four thousand. 1 Then … WebContext Summary Matthew 15:21–28 describes an encounter between Jesus and a Gentile woman. She knows Jesus is the Messiah and tells Him her daughter is severely oppressed by a demon. At first, Jesus chooses not to cast the demon out. He tells the woman His mission is only to Israel, using a metaphor about table scraps.
